Abstract

The utility model relates to an interface-expandable smart card reader-writer which comprises a radio frequency reader-writer module, a consumption processing module, a security chip module, a storage module, a power supply and a display module. The radio frequency reader-writer module is used for reading and writing an IC (integrated circuit) card, the consumption processing module is used for processing consumption data of the radio frequency reader-writer module, the security chip module is used for connecting the consumption processing module with a security chip to guarantee consumption data processing security of the consumption processing module, the storage module is used for storing corresponding consumption data, the power supply is used for providing working power of the interface-expandable smart card reader-writer, the display module is used for displaying processing results of the consumption processing module, and the consumption processing module is respectively connected with the radio frequency reader-writer module, the security chip module, the storage module, the power supply and the display module. The interface-expandable smart card reader-writer is good in compatibility.

Embodiment
Below in conjunction with diagram, preferred embodiment of the present utility model is described in detail.
Please refer to Fig. 1, Fig. 1 is the structural representation of preferred embodiment of the intelligent card read/write device of extensive interface of the present utility model.The intelligent card read/write device of the extensive interface of this preferred embodiment comprises consumption processing module 10, frequency read/write module 11, safety chip module 12, memory module 13, display module 14, alarm module 15, clock module 16 and power supply 17.Wherein consuming processing module 10 is used for the consumption data of radio frequency reader/writer module 11 is processed; Frequency read/write module 11 is used for IC is read and write processing, and it communicates by antenna 18 and corresponding IC-card; Safety chip module 12 is used for connecting consumption processing module 10 and safety chip 19, guarantees to consume by the data in safety chip 19 security that processing module 10 is processed consumption data; Memory module 13 is used for storing corresponding consumption data; Display module 14 is used for showing the result of consumption processing module 10, can be the LED display circuit; Alarm module 15 is used for sending warning message, as sound or vibrations warning etc.; Clock module 16 is used for providing the timing service; Power supply 17 is used for providing the working power of each module of intelligent card read/write device of extensive interface, and its specific works situation according to each module can provide 5V Voltage-output source and 3.3V Voltage-output source.This consumption processing module 10 is connected with frequency read/write module 11, safety chip module 12, memory module 13, display module 14, alarm module 15, clock module 16 and power supply 17 respectively.
The consumption processing module 10 of the intelligent card read/write device of the extensive interface of this preferred embodiment adopts the microcontroller of model STM32F103ZET6, as shown in Figure 2, Fig. 2 is the physical circuit figure of consumption processing module of the intelligent card read/write device of extensive interface of the present utility model.This microcontroller provides 3 12 analog to digital converter ports, 112 quick I/O ports and a plurality of communication interface, therefore this microcontroller can provide a plurality of expansion interfaces to be used for connecting a plurality of frequency read/write modules 11, thereby has improved the compatibility of intelligent card read/write device of the extensive interface of this preferred embodiment.
Please refer to Fig. 2, Fig. 3 and Fig. 4, Fig. 3 is the physical circuit figure of frequency read/write module of the intelligent card read/write device of extensive interface of the present utility model, and Fig. 4 is the physical circuit figure of antenna of the intelligent card read/write device of extensive interface of the present utility model.Frequency read/write module 11 is the frequency read/write of the frequency 13.56MHz of model PN532, microcontroller is connected with frequency read/write by 41 pin SPI1_SCK, 42 pin SPI1_MISO, 43 pin SPI1_MOSI and 135 pin SPI1_SS1, frequency read/write is connected with corresponding antenna 18 by 4 pin TX1,6 pin TX2,9 pin VMID and 10 pin RX, to realize and the data communication of IC-card accordingly.
Please refer to Fig. 2 and Fig. 5, Fig. 5 is the physical circuit figure of memory module of the intelligent card read/write device of extensive interface of the present utility model.Memory module 13 is the flash chip of model SST25VF032B, microcontroller is connected with this flash chip by 41 pin SPI1_SCK, 42 pin SPI1_MISO, 43 pin SPI1_MOSI, 46 pin SPI1_NSS2 and 47 pin SPI1_NSS3, reads and writes consumption data to facilitate microcontroller from flash chip.
Please refer to Fig. 2 and Fig. 6, Fig. 6 is the physical circuit figure of safety chip module of the intelligent card read/write device of extensive interface of the present utility model.Safety chip module 12 is that around being reached by the two intelligent card interfaces of model TDA8020HL single-chip, element is built, and it is by I 2The total line traffic control of C utilizes considerably less outer member to guarantee to meet ISO 7816 or EMV standard.Microcontroller is connected with this safety chip module 12 by 36 pin PSAM_TXD, 40 pin PSAM_CLK, 122 pin I2C_SCL and 123 pin I2C_SDA, read corresponding secure data by safety chip module 12 with convenient from corresponding safety chip 19, guarantee the security of microcontroller processing consumption data.
Please refer to Fig. 2 and Fig. 7, Fig. 7 is the physical circuit figure of interface of display module of the intelligent card read/write device of extensive interface of the present utility model.Microcontroller is connected with display module 14 by pin SPI2_SS1,74 pin SPI2_SCK, 75 pin SPI2_MISO and 76 pin SPI2_MOSI, and the display module 14 here can be any display circuit, as the LED display circuit; Can be used to show microprocessor to the result of consumption data, as the consumption amount of money of IC-card and the remaining sum of IC-card etc.
Please refer to Fig. 2 and Fig. 8, Fig. 8 is the physical circuit figure of alarm module of the intelligent card read/write device of extensive interface of the present utility model.Microcontroller is connected with alarm module 15 by 34 pin BUZ_CE.When microcontroller finds that consumption data is abnormal, Sorry, your ticket has not enough value processing this consumption as IC-card, or the IC-card remaining sum can be sent alarm sound when few.Certainly also can process the confirmation signal of all sounding and processing as normal consumption to every subnormal consumption here.
Please refer to Fig. 2 and Fig. 9, Fig. 9 is the physical circuit figure of clock module of the intelligent card read/write device of extensive interface of the present utility model.Clock module 16 is the chip of model FM3130, and microcontroller is connected with clock module 16 by 122 pin I2C_SCL and 123 pin I2C_SDA, in time to obtain the temporal information of clock module 16.
Please refer to Figure 10, Figure 10 is the physical circuit figure of power supply of the intelligent card read/write device of extensive interface of the present utility model.Wherein power supply 17 comprises 5V Voltage-output source and 3.3V Voltage-output source, and wherein 5V Voltage-output source directly obtains 5V voltage from outside (as USB interface); It is stable 3.3V Voltage-output with the 5V voltage transitions that 3.3V Voltage-output source becomes by the voltage-regulation chip, thereby satisfies the power supply needs of each module under the intelligent card read/write device of extensive interface.
When the intelligent card read/write device of extensive interface of the present utility model is worked, consumption processing module 10 can read the check information of IC-card indirectly according to the Card Reader program that is stored in internal storage by frequency read/write module 11, then will read secure data in safety chip 19 by safety chip module 12, carry out verification with the check information to IC-card, thereby this IC-card is carried out the validity judgement.Be effectively to block as this IC-card, consume processing module 10 and read the consumption information (being mainly balance amount information) of this IC-card, and the card program of writing that this consumption information carries out after fee deduction treatment being stored according to consumption processing module 10 internal storage is written in IC-card by frequency read/write module 11; Simultaneously this consumption information is stored in memory module 13, and by on display module 14, the user being shown.Be dead card as this IC-card, directly carry out by 14 couples of users of display module the prompting that IC-card is made mistakes, carry out alarm by 15 couples of users of alarm module simultaneously.So namely completed an IC-card read-write operation of the intelligent card read/write device of extensive interface of the present utility model.
